区块链移动数据库是什么?
区块链移动数据库是一种结合了区块链技术和移动应用的新型数据库。传统数据库主要用于存储和管理数据,而区块链移动数据库则更注重数据的安全性和去中心化特点。它使用分布式的共识机制来确保数据的一致性,同时还具备去中心化的特点,不依赖特定的服务器或数据中心。区块链移动数据库在移动应用领域中有着广泛的应用,可以提供更安全、透明和可追溯的数据管理解决方案。
区块链移动数据库有哪些特点?
区块链移动数据库具有以下几个特点:
1. 数据安全性高:区块链技术使用密码学算法来保证数据的安全性,将数据分散存储在多个节点上,通过共识机制保证数据的一致性和可靠性。
2. 去中心化特点:区块链移动数据库不依赖特定的服务器或数据中心,数据存储在多个节点上,没有单点故障,提高了系统的可靠性和可用性。
3. 数据透明性和可追溯性:由于区块链的开放性特点,所有的数据变更都被记录在不可篡改的分布式账本中,任何人都可以随时查看和验证数据的完整性。
4. 智能合约支持:区块链移动数据库通过智能合约技术,可以在移动应用中实现自动化的业务逻辑和数据处理,提高系统的效率和可靠性。
区块链移动数据库在移动应用中的应用场景有哪些?
区块链移动数据库可以在移动应用中应用于以下场景:
1. 供应链管理:通过区块链移动数据库可以实现供应链中的货物跟踪和溯源,确保产品的真实性和安全性。
2. 共享经济:区块链移动数据库可以实现共享经济平台中的交易数据的可信度和透明度,提高用户信任和交易效率。
3. 物联网应用:通过区块链移动数据库可以实现物联网设备之间的可靠数据交互和身份验证,增加物联网应用的安全性。
4. 数字身份管理:区块链移动数据库可以实现用户数字身份的安全管理和验证,减少身份盗用和欺诈。
5. 信息流通场景:区块链移动数据库可以用于保护用户隐私、验证信息的可信度和版权保护等信息流通场景。
区块链移动数据库与传统数据库有何区别?
区块链移动数据库与传统数据库相比有以下几个区别:
1. 存储方式不同:传统数据库将数据存储在中心化的服务器或数据中心中,而区块链移动数据库将数据分散存储在多个节点上。
2. 数据一致性和安全性:传统数据库依赖于中心化的权威机构来维护数据的一致性和安全性,而区块链移动数据库通过共识机制和密码学算法来保证数据的一致性和安全性。
3. 数据透明度和可追溯性:传统数据库中的数据变更往往只有系统管理员可见,而区块链移动数据库中的数据变更记录被保存在分布式账本中,任何人都可以查看和验证。
4. 系统可用性和容错性:传统数据库存在单点故障的风险,系统可用性相对较低,而区块链移动数据库通过去中心化的特点,提高了系统的可用性和容错性。
如何选择合适的区块链移动数据库?
在选择合适的区块链移动数据库时,可以考虑以下几个因素:
1. 数据安全性需求:根据自身应用的数据安全性需求,选择提供更高级别加密和认证功能的区块链移动数据库。
2. 性能和扩展性要求:根据自身应用的性能需求和未来扩展的可能性,选择具备高性能和良好扩展性的区块链移动数据库。
3. 开发和部署成本:考虑区块链移动数据库的开发和部署成本,选择适合自身预算和资源的数据库。
4. 社区和生态支持:选择有活跃社区和丰富生态支持的区块链移动数据库,能够获得更多的技术支持和资源。
5. 可信度和可靠性:选择经过验证和广泛应用的区块链移动数据库,确保系统的可信度和可靠性。